Output e5c22fcd55b32a25d86a7053b98896bd71fe34d2fedbcca99308557e46bb33d9:0

value
28028517
script pubkey
OP_0 OP_PUSHBYTES_20 ebc7cb1f3921151bba4e551d3cfa6b08ee793a54
address
bc1qa0ruk8eeyy23hwjw25wne7ntprh8jwj595wf69
transaction
e5c22fcd55b32a25d86a7053b98896bd71fe34d2fedbcca99308557e46bb33d9